Democrat Chris Pappas is Running for Congress in NH CD-1

The speculation is over. (I confess I forgot he was considering it.) Executive Councilor Chris Pappas is going to run for Congress in New Hampshire Congressional District one. 603 alternate banner 4The Democrats won two more House special elections in New Hampshire yesterday improving their numbers in the legislature.

Two special elections were suited as tests to see whether the Republican Party could stem its series of defeats in the General Court.

So far in 2017, Republicans have lost eight of 10 special elections, including seven of nine in the General Court. Ultimately, the Democrats took seats on the ballot in Hillsborough District 15 as well as Sullivan District 1.
